India has requested a halt to the deployment of Indian seamen on ships transiting the Strait of Hormuz, citing heightened regional tensions. The move follows recent attacks on commercial vessels in the critical waterway. New Delhi is concerned for the safety of its citizens given the escalating security risks. Indian authorities are advising shipping companies to reroute vessels or explore alternative crewing arrangements. This directive aims to protect Indian nationals from potential threats in a volatile maritime environment. The situation remains fluid, and India continues to monitor developments closely in the region. The government is prioritizing the well-being of its seafarers amid ongoing geopolitical uncertainty.
